No I'm not talking politics here. The big brown truck (UPS) came and brought two Super Grades, a 220 Swift and a 300 H&H. Both guns are a solid 95% as far as wood and metal finish goes maybe a little better. They both lack the swivels unfortunately but I can live with that. I'll get the 300 scoped up and start working up a suitable deer load immediately. I'm thinking a 150gr Hornady or a 165gr NBT. To the best of my knowledge the pad is original. It matches the markings and description in Rules book. I have another 300 H&H a std rifle that has the metal but plate.
Both of these guns are one owner guns from an estate. Local guy who retired from GM. They have seen very little use. The Swift dates to 1953 the H&H to 1958.
